What Is QEEG as a Diagnostic Tool?

QEEG — an abbreviation for quantitative EEG analysis — is a non-invasive clinical tool that captures and interprets the brainwave patterns generated throughout your brain. While a traditional EEG, which only records raw brainwaves, a QEEG applies sophisticated digital analysis tools to compare your brain's activity against a large normative database.

The outcome is a detailed, color-coded QEEG report that highlights the parts of your brain are operating outside normal ranges. Our team can detect patterns linked to anxiety and depression, chronic pain conditions, and a wide range of neurological concerns.

The QEEG Procedure Explained

  1. Clinical Background Evaluation — Everything kicks off with a thorough intake session during which our clinicians collect your medical background, ongoing complaints, and previous assessments or treatments. This enables our clinicians to set up your assessment from an informed perspective.
  2. Fitting the EEG Cap — A soft sensor cap containing multiple recording points is positioned on your scalp. The sensors only record — no signals are transmitted to you — and record the brainwave activity your brain already produces.
  3. Neural Signal Collection — You will be asked to relax in a chair in a relaxed state for roughly 15 to 20 minutes while the system measures your brainwave data at multiple brain sites simultaneously.
  4. Computational Brain Mapping — The raw EEG data is analyzed using advanced computational tools that produce a visual neural profile by measuring your results against a normative database. The result is a highly detailed map of where your brain diverges from normal ranges.
  5. Expert Analysis of Results — One of our qualified neurological specialists analyzes the full QEEG report in full, identifying patterns tied to your symptoms. Here, the results transforms into a treatment plan.
  6. Walking You Through the Report — You'll sit down with your provider to review your QEEG brain map in clear terms. You'll gain insight into the specific neural areas displayed irregular activity and how that connects for your recovery journey.
  7. Personalized Treatment Recommendations — Based on your brain map findings, our providers develop a tailored treatment program that may include cognitive rehabilitation therapies alongside additional neurological support.

QEEG Common Questions Answered

What is the typical duration of a QEEG?

The full QEEG session usually runs roughly 60–90 minutes from consultation to cap-off. The brainwave capture portion occupies roughly 15–25 minutes, with the remaining time focused on fitting the cap and reviewing history.

Does QEEG cause any pain?

There is no pain associated with QEEG. The electrode cap rests comfortably on your head and only captures your brain's natural activity. Occasionally, individuals experience minor scalp awareness when the cap is fitted, but it passes immediately once you settle in.

How long do QEEG results remain valid?

Your initial brain map remains clinically useful for six to twelve months, based on your treatment progress. Many clients have a second QEEG session once therapy is underway to document improvements in brain function read more using hard data.

What does QEEG commonly detect?

QEEG has been used to identify numerous brain-based disorders, including traumatic brain injury, attention dysregulation, PTSD, autism spectrum conditions, and sleep disorders. The assessment does not replace a full clinical evaluation — it informs a broader diagnostic picture.
